Transaction 523116e184428160e39f0867f2af8263c7a645074742d73b7cef4a274c6e36fd

1 Input
2 Outputs
  • 523116e184428160e39f0867f2af8263c7a645074742d73b7cef4a274c6e36fd:0
  • value  58103
    address  18bjePYYdjQ7JJPxrJPkuxS2nbE7fM36ZT
  • 523116e184428160e39f0867f2af8263c7a645074742d73b7cef4a274c6e36fd:1
  • value  1807953779
    address  1EUqwVzqWUJuDo4PuJEyqym2Dab9x5q76C